Solar panels are a fantastic way to harness the power of the sun and generate clean energy for your home. Nevertheless, like any other technology, they require routine maintenance to ensure optimal performance. One aspect of solar panel care is cleaning them regularly.

Over time, dust, pollen, bird droppings, and even leaves can accumulate on the surface of your panels, reducing sunlight and decreasing energy production. Thankfully, keeping your website panels clean is a fairly simple task.

Here are some tricks to maximize your solar panel output through proper cleaning and maintenance:

* **Regular Cleaning:** Aim to clean your panels at least twice, depending on your location and environmental conditions.

* **Gentle Cleaning Solution:** Use a mild detergent or soap solution mixed with water.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asives, which can damage the delicate surface of your panels.

* **Soft Brushes:** Employ soft-bristled brushes or sponges to gently scrub the panels. Avoid using anything abrasive that could scratch the glass.

* **Rinse Thoroughly:** After cleaning, rinse the panels thoroughly with clean water to remove all traces of soap or debris.

* **Professional Inspections:** Consider having your solar panels professionally inspected annually to identify any potential issues and ensure they are operating at peak efficiency.

Following these easy steps can help you keep your solar panels clean, efficient, and extend their lifespan for years to come.

Maximize Your Energy Efficiency: Simple Solar Panel Cleaning Techniques

Keeping your solar panels clean is essential for maximizing their energy production. Dirt can accumulate on the panels, reducing their ability to absorb sunlight and generate electricity. Luckily, there are simple techniques you can use to polish your panels and maximize your energy savings.

  • First inspecting your solar panels for any visible dirt. You can use a soft-bristled brush to gently remove the deposit.
  • Do not employ harsh chemicals or abrasive materials, as they can damage the surface. A mild soap solution and a microfiber cloth are usually sufficient.
  • Periodically cleaning your solar panels can help improve their efficiency by up to 20%. Setting aside a few minutes every few months for cleaning is a worthwhile investment.
